  • Abstract
    The cross sections of many important nuclides are represented in Reich±Moore (RM) formalism in the recent American Evaluated Nuclear Data file, ENDF/B-VI. Processing of cross sections with RM resonance parameters is much more dicult than the other multilevel formalisms such as MLBW and Adler±Adler. In this paper, we derive a rational approxima- tion to the RM collision matrix in the vicinity of a resonance. This simplifies the cross section processing. The energy range of the validity of this approximation in the vicinity of a reso- nance is also derived. Choosing Ni58 as an example, results of our approximation for a non- fissile nuclide are given for two typical s-wave resonances. Our rational approximation method is found to work with good accuracies in the vicinity of resonances
